Snow service you can prove happened

In Alberta a snow contract is a liability document as much as a service. Ours defines the trigger depth, the response window and the priority order, then records every visit with a time stamp.

The approach

Open sites, documented service, defensible files.

Slip-and-fall claims are won and lost on records. We monitor the forecast, dispatch on a defined trigger, clear in a set priority order, and log each attendance with time and date. When a claim lands two years later, the file is already built.

The detail

How the work is set up.

  • TriggerSet per site, commonly 5cm for lots and 2cm for walks, or on-call
  • ResponseClearing underway within the contracted window from trigger
  • RecordsDate and time-stamped log for every attendance, available on request
  • SeasonNovember 1 through March 31, extended by agreement
